Regional network
California’s Small Business Development Center program began operating in 1989 and has grown to 45 centers, outnumbering all other states.
The State of California is organized into 6 regions, each having a lead center and hosted branch offices. Each region corresponds with the SBA district offices.
For the Greater Los Angeles area, The Long Beach Community College is the Lead Center, providing leadership to 10 SBDCs in Los Angeles, Ventura and Santa Barbara Counties.
